Cultural and classical interpretation

Dress and veil symbols thread through rite-of-passage folklore—marriage, mourning, initiation—while modern dreams tilt workplace persona, gender performance, and social media visibility.

Research-backed context

About dress (waking reference): A dress is a one-piece outer garment that is worn on the torso, hanging down over the legs. Dresses often consist of a bodice attached to a skirt. In dreams, this background informs—but does not replace—your scene and emotion.
